as in the 1st post, I have posted the mods to the engine.. but they weren't definite. so.. here's an updated list;
40thou over
10thou off the head
15thou off the block
blueprinted and balanced crank, rods and cam
billet 30/70 waggot cam
ported and polished head
larger valves
32/36 webber downdraught carb jetted to suit the cam
tuned lengthed 4-2-1 extractors that have been heat wrapped
2" exhaust with lukey muffler on the rear
flat top pistons
9.5:1 comp ratio
jap 5 speed
exedy clutch
lowered god knows how much! (its low! lca's are 70mm from the ground, diff centre is between 50-70mm... and the exhaust is about 40mm..)
larger alternator
rebuilt when I bought it back when.. (right down to every nut, bolt, welsh plug and screw)
xr3000 electronic ignition
